Understanding Standard Maintenance Services

Though numerous car owners focus on repairs solely when problems occur, comprehending regular maintenance procedures is crucial for extending a vehicle's longevity and ensuring peak performance. Scheduled maintenance covers numerous tasks, like oil changes, tire rotations, and fluid checks, which aid in preventing major, expensive issues down the line. By adhering to the manufacturer's recommended service schedule, vehicle owners can boost engine efficiency, boost gas mileage, and maintain safety standards.

Moreover, regular inspections can pinpoint potential issues early, permitting timely repairs that minimize the risk of breakdowns. This proactive approach not only ensures optimal functionality but also safeguards the vehicle's resale value. Overlooking these services can cause deterioration of critical components, elevating the likelihood of extensive repairs. Therefore, vehicle owners advantage substantially from prioritizing routine maintenance, cultivating reliability and a smoother driving experience over time.

Common Wiring Problems

Why does a vehicle's electrical system malfunction without prior notice? Typical electrical issues frequently stem from a variety of factors, such as deteriorated cables, corroded connections, or deteriorating systems. These issues can lead to symptoms like fading lights, malfunctioning dashboard lights, or a unresponsive starting mechanism. Battery problems are particularly prevalent; a failing or exhausted battery can affect the entire power system. Moreover, faulty alternators may fail to charge the battery effectively, causing further complications. Additional issues encompass damaged fuses, which can disrupt electricity flow to critical components, and issues with the starter motor, preventing the engine from starting. Understanding these standard electrical malfunctions is crucial for prompt identification and successful restoration to guarantee vehicle reliability.

Diagnostic Equipment Overview

Accurate diagnosis of electrical system issues in vehicles requires a collection of specialized tools that can pinpoint problems accurately. Technicians frequently use multimeters to measure current, voltage, and resistance, supplying crucial data on electrical circuits. Oscilloscopes are similarly important, capturing waveforms to reveal irregularities in signal quality and timing. Scan tools, which communicate with a vehicle's onboard diagnostics, can identify fault codes that signal specific electrical defects. Moreover, circuit testers help check the integrity of connections, while battery testers assess battery health and performance. Combined, these diagnostic tools allow technicians to effectively diagnose and evaluate electrical problems, creating the basis for effective repairs and ensuring the vehicle operates consistently.

Restoration Process Detailed

A thorough repair process for electrical system issues initiates with a systematic approach to determining the problem. Technicians use advanced diagnostic tools to pinpoint malfunctions, examining components such as the battery, alternator, and wiring harnesses for faults. They often commence by analyzing error codes from the vehicle's onboard computer, which provides valuable insights into the electrical system's performance. Visual inspections come next, where worn-out or damaged parts are identified. After pinpointing the source of the issue, technicians establish a repair plan that includes needed parts replacements or repairs. Finally, they conduct tests to verify the system operates correctly before finalizing the service. This meticulous process guarantees that electrical problems are efficiently resolved and the vehicle is safe to operate.

Resolving Problems with Brakes and Suspension

Brake and suspension issues are critical concerns for vehicle safety and performance. The braking system, including components like pads, rotors, and calipers, requires regular inspection to guarantee effective stopping power. Degraded brake pads often lead to compromised performance and greater stopping distances, representing a considerable risk. Similarly, suspension problems can affect ride quality and handling. Parts like shocks, struts, and springs function together to preserve vehicle stability and comfort. Evidence of suspension concerns includes excessive bouncing, asymmetrical tire wear, or a distinct vehicle angle.

When handling these problems, technicians utilize diagnostic tools and perform visual inspections to detect specific faults. Timely repairs not only enhance safety but also extend the vehicle's lifespan. Regular maintenance of brakes and suspension systems is crucial for superior driving conditions, guaranteeing that vehicles can perform effectively to the requirements of the road.

Transmission Replacement and Repair

Transmission repair and replacement services are essential for guaranteeing a vehicle's efficient operation and complete performance. The transmission, accountable for transmitting power from the engine to the wheels, performs an essential function in a vehicle's functionality. When issues arise, such as gears that slip, uncommon noises, or fluid seepage, prompt evaluation by a certified mechanic is essential.

Service and repair may encompass diagnosing and correcting minor concerns, including seal or gasket replacement, or handling more serious matters, such as replacing whole transmission assemblies. In cases where repair is not feasible, replacement with a remanufactured or new transmission can restore the vehicle's performance.

Regular maintenance, including fluid changes and inspections, can help prevent major transmission failures. Ultimately, comprehending the value of transmission services empowers vehicle owners to make knowledgeable decisions, keeping their vehicles reliable and efficient while driving.

Wheel Alignment and Tire Care Solutions

While countless drivers often neglect the read about this importance of tire services and wheel alignment, these elements are crucial for maintaining ideal handling and safety on the road. Correct tire maintenance encompasses regular checks, rotations, and balancing to guarantee even wear and extended tire life. Ignoring these services can cause lower traction, increased fuel consumption, and ultimately, pricey replacements.

Wheel alignment, in contrast, ensures that all four wheels are accurately aligned in relation to each other and the road. Improper alignment may occur from hitting obstacles such as curbs or potholes, and it may cause irregular tire wear and compromised steering response. Regular alignment checks can aid in preventing these problems and improve vehicle stability.

Battery Service and Replacement

A key factor of caring for hybrid and electric vehicles is effective battery maintenance and replacement. These vehicles utilize advanced battery systems that require specialized care to maintain superior performance and longevity. Regular inspections are essential to recognize any signs of wear, rust, or decline. Effective charging practices and temperature management also play vital roles in maximizing battery life. When replacement becomes essential, it is important to use OEM-approved batteries to maintain vehicle efficiency and safety. Technicians experienced in hybrid and electric vehicle systems are prepared to handle these tasks, ensuring that the battery functions efficiently within the vehicle's overall electrical ecosystem. This specialized knowledge is invaluable for drivers seeking to maximize their vehicle's lifespan and performance.

What Are Frequent Signs My Vehicle Needs Repair Work?

Common signs a vehicle needs maintenance include odd mechanical sounds, warning lights on the dashboard, fluid leaks, lower operational capability, and vibrations while operating the vehicle. Disregarding these signals may bring about more serious complications and expensive service work.

At What Intervals Should I Get My Vehicle Inspected?

Experts generally recommend getting a vehicle inspected no less than once per year. Even so, inspection frequency can increase based on mileage, age, and specific manufacturer guidelines, ensuring safety and peak performance while potentially preventing costly repairs.
